Sacajawea, A Guide and Interpreter of the Lewis and Clark Expedition, with an Account of the Travels of Toussaint Charbonneau, and of Jean Baptiste, the Expedition Papoose. Glendale: The Arthur H. Clark Company, 1957. Octavo, gilt blocked blue cloth, 340 pages. Illustrated. Now offered for your consideration is this 1957 look at the life of Sacajawea, A Guide and Interpreter of the Lewis and Clark Expedition. From the preface: “In this volume the author has also sought to unravel the tangled skein of Sacajawea’s family life; to trace the career of her son, Baptiste…..to portray as accurately as possible her personal traits and characteristics; to trace her wanderings far and wide through the west; and especially to record the significant services she rendered not only as a guide to Lewis and Clark but also for many years and on many occasions as counselor to her own people…” Condition notes: Very good.
